Greyhounds are gentle, noble, and sweet-tempered giants. They are lean and built for high speed pursuit, but are also content to lounge around the house all day.

November is Senior Pet Month and Adopt a Senior Pet Month. Did you know over 6.5 million pets are turned in to U.S. animal shelters every year, and a large number of those pets are seniors? We can't think of a better way to honor our senior friends this month than opening your home to adopting (or even fostering!) a senior dog or cat.
